Default C5 brake conversion, uneven pad wear ???

Did the C5 conversion on my camaro, and am running hawk HPS up front. My brakes started to squel and I pulled the tires off to check. Both of the inside pads are almost completely worn and both outside pads are relatively fresh. What would cause the inside pads to wear like this?

did u replace all the brake hardware? Usually that means the slider pins are stuck so the piston ends up just pushing on the inside pad instead of pulling the outside as it pushes.

Did you lube the pins that slide in/out?
